Output 98014ec21e33bd5cf5c3064db6d4a5137aa5df1b456b1f3bd0e1ac47972f67a5:0

value
655897
script pubkey
OP_0 OP_PUSHBYTES_20 bea7d53d40b99d324ea2bece2971d81ba8990ab7
address
bc1qh6na202qhxwnyn4zhm8zjuwcrw5fjz4hda9gmy
transaction
98014ec21e33bd5cf5c3064db6d4a5137aa5df1b456b1f3bd0e1ac47972f67a5
spent
true